SnapCheck is a modular, read-only audit platform for DevOps/MLOps estates.
It inspects Terraform, Kubernetes, Helm, CI/CD, Docker registries, secrets, AWS costs, and GitOps — then correlates signals to tell you what broke, why, and what changed since last time.


🌍 Why SnapCheck Exists

Modern engineering teams live across 10+ tools — Terraform for infra, Kubernetes for workloads, GitHub for CI/CD, Helm for packaging, AWS Cost Explorer for finance, and so on.
When something goes wrong, finding the root cause often means hours of context switching and digging through logs.

SnapCheck fixes this by:

  • Pulling signals from all your critical systems in one pass.
  • Correlating events into human-readable storylines (e.g., Terraform drift → Helm failure → CI/CD latency → cost anomaly).
  • Producing shareable, portable HTML & Markdown reports for audits, reviews, and compliance.
  • Enforcing safe-by-default access with OAuth + RBAC.

🚀 Core Features

Capability Highlights
Terraform Local/remote .tfstate, drift detection, IAM wildcard/admin checks, stale resources, cost estimates
Kubernetes Node readiness/pressure, pod health, restart spikes, PVC issues, DNS & service reachability, basic security context checks
Helm List releases, detect failed upgrades, outdated charts, values drift
CI/CD (GitHub) Longest jobs, average duration, flakiness, commit→deploy latency, branch protection enforcement
Docker Remote registry scans (Docker Hub/GHCR), tags/manifests, metadata & CVEs
Secrets GitHub Actions secrets, Kubernetes secrets, regex leak detection, age tracking
Cost (AWS CE) Real monthly AWS spend by service, Terraform-managed vs unmanaged cost delta
GitOps (Argo CD) App health, sync status, revision drift, failed syncs, auto-sync flag
Correlation Engine Root cause vs symptom, regression detection, severity tagging

🖥️ Architecture Overview

Architecture Diagram

How it works:

  1. snapcheck run loads a profile (YAML config for env, creds, modules).
  2. Plugins run in parallel-ish to collect signals from their sources.
  3. Correlation engine links findings into storylines.
  4. Output generated in:
    • Terminal
    • Markdown
    • HTML Dashboard (Tailwind + Chart.js)
  5. .snapcheck/history/ stores past runs for trends & regression detection.

🔐 Security & Compliance
Authentication: GitHub OAuth2 (scopes: read:user, user:email, read:org if org allowlist).

Authorization: RBAC via YAML (viewer, engineer, admin).

Secrets: Environment or vault only; no plaintext creds in repo.

Transport: TLS recommended; https_only: true in production.

Data at Rest: Reports can be kept offline or in private Pages/S3.

Audit Logging: Pluggable backends (file/SQLite/S3) for access events.
